- 1、本文档共33页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
数智创新变革未来数据库系统性能优化
数据库性能概述
性能评估与监测工具
查询优化技术
索引策略与优化
数据库架构优化
并发与锁管理
数据备份与恢复策略
性能优化实践案例ContentsPage目录页
数据库性能概述数据库系统性能优化
数据库性能概述数据库性能定义与重要性1.数据库性能指的是数据库系统响应查询和事务处理的速度和效率。2.高性能的数据库系统是应用程序稳定运行的关键,可以保证数据的可靠性和用户体验。数据库性能评估指标1.响应时间:指系统对请求做出响应的时间,包括查询和事务处理的执行时间。2.吞吐量:指系统在单位时间内可以处理的请求数量,衡量系统的整体处理能力。
数据库性能概述影响数据库性能的因素1.硬件资源:包括服务器性能、存储设备、网络带宽等,对数据库性能有着至关重要的影响。2.数据库设计:合理的表结构、索引设计和查询优化等,可以提高数据库性能。数据库性能优化方法1.优化查询语句:通过重写查询语句、使用索引等手段,提高查询效率。2.调整数据库参数:合理配置数据库系统参数,可以根据实际情况进行优化。
数据库性能概述数据库性能监控与分析1.实时监控:通过监控工具实时观察数据库系统的运行状态,及时发现性能问题。2.性能分析:对性能问题进行深入分析,找出性能瓶颈,为优化提供依据。数据库性能发展趋势1.云计算:利用云计算资源池化和弹性扩展的优势,可以提高数据库系统的性能和稳定性。2.分布式数据库:分布式数据库系统可以支持更大的数据规模和更高的并发访问,成为未来数据库性能优化的重要方向。
性能评估与监测工具数据库系统性能优化
性能评估与监测工具性能评估与监测工具概述1.性能评估与监测工具的作用:帮助数据库管理员更好地了解数据库系统的性能状况,定位性能瓶颈,优化系统配置。2.常见性能评估与监测工具:OracleEnterpriseManager、MySQLWorkbench、MicrosoftSQLServerManagementStudio等。3.工具选择考虑因素:支持的数据库类型、功能、易用性、价格等。性能评估与监测工具的功能特点1.实时监控:实时监测数据库系统的各项性能指标,如CPU使用率、内存占用率、磁盘I/O等。2.历史数据分析:分析历史性能数据,帮助管理员了解系统性能趋势和瓶颈。3.告警功能:设置性能阈值,当系统性能超过或低于阈值时发送告警通知。
性能评估与监测工具性能评估与监测工具的使用流程1.安装与配置:根据工具提供的文档和指南,完成工具的安装和配置。2.数据采集:工具采集数据库系统的性能数据,包括实时数据和历史数据。3.分析与优化:根据性能数据,分析系统瓶颈,进行相应的优化操作。性能评估与监测工具的优化建议1.根据实际情况调整阈值:根据数据库系统的实际情况,调整性能阈值,提高告警准确性。2.定期检查工具配置:定期检查工具的配置情况,确保工具正常运行。3.结合其他优化手段:结合其他数据库优化手段,如索引优化、查询优化等,提高系统整体性能。
性能评估与监测工具性能评估与监测工具的发展趋势1.云计算支持:越来越多的性能评估与监测工具开始支持云计算环境,满足云计算数据库的性能监测需求。2.AI技术应用:人工智能技术在性能评估与监测工具中的应用越来越广泛,帮助管理员更加精准地定位性能问题。3.跨平台支持:随着数据库系统的多样化,跨平台支持成为性能评估与监测工具的必备功能之一。性能评估与监测工具的案例分享1.案例一:通过使用性能评估与监测工具,某电商企业成功解决了数据库系统性能瓶颈,提高了网站访问速度和用户体验。2.案例二:某金融企业通过性能评估与监测工具,实现了对数据库系统的精细化管理,降低了运维成本,提高了业务连续性。
查询优化技术数据库系统性能优化
查询优化技术查询优化技术简介1.查询优化技术是提高数据库系统性能的重要手段。2.通过优化查询语句和执行计划,减少磁盘I/O操作,提高查询速度。3.查询优化技术包括多个方面,如索引优化、查询语句优化、数据库表结构设计等。索引优化1.索引是提高查询速度的重要手段,通过创建合适的索引可以大幅度提高查询性能。2.索引的创建需要根据查询语句和表结构进行综合分析,避免过度索引和无效索引。3.在进行索引优化时,需要考虑索引的类型、创建方式、维护成本等因素。
查询优化技术查询语句优化1.优化查询语句可以减少数据库系统的负载,提高查询效率。2.通过分析查询语句的执行计划,找出性能瓶颈,进行针对性的优化。3.常见的查询语句优化手段包括使用连接代替子查询、使用EXISTS代替IN等。数据库表结构设计优化1.合理的数据库表结构设计可以提高查询效率和数据一致性。2.在进行表结构设计时,需要考虑数据的冗余度、完整性约束、数据类型等因素。3.通过使用分区表、视
文档评论(0)